Default clutch, differential or axle??!! help!!!

98 JDM type R. car will only shudder under load. Especially during highway speeds. Thought it was wheels, so got them all rebalanced but nothing. Engine revs fine when I step on the clutch but as soon as it engages again the car will shudder like it has a warped rotor when I step on the gas. does it in all gears. Didn't start doing it till after a car wash!! weird. could it be differential, bound axel? or clutch? was stuck in traffic two days ago and after I got off ramp the car smelled like burnt clutch for a good 15 minutes.....could this be the culprit? ACT HDSS clutch with prolite flywheel..... any recomendations would be greatly appreciated.
